heterodox

/ˌhɛtəˈrɒkdɒks/

Definitions

1. adjective

deviating from established or traditional views, practices, or opinions; unconventional

“The artist’s heterodox style of painting sparked controversy in the art world.”

2. noun

a person or thing that holds or represents such views or practices

“The heterodox movement in the city gained popularity among the younger generation.”

Synonyms

  • unconventional
  • unorthodox

Antonyms

  • conventional
  • orthodox
